Healthy, vibrant flower beds begin with fertile soil. The condition of your soil directly impacts the growth, color, and longevity of your flowers. Over time, soils can become depleted of essential nutrients, lose their structure, or develop poor drainage. To restore and maintain the vitality of your flower beds, organic soil amendments are an excellent solution. They not only enhance the physical and chemical properties of the soil but also support beneficial microbial activity crucial for plant health.

In this article, we will explore the best organic soil amendments to improve flower beds, how they work, and tips on application to help your flowers thrive.

Why Use Organic Soil Amendments?

Organic soil amendments are natural materials derived from plant or animal sources. Unlike synthetic fertilizers that provide only specific nutrients, organic amendments improve the overall soil ecosystem by:

  • Enhancing soil structure and aeration
  • Increasing nutrient availability and retention
  • Supporting beneficial microorganisms
  • Improving water retention or drainage depending on need
  • Contributing to long-term soil fertility without harmful chemicals

These benefits create an ideal environment for flowers to grow strong roots and produce beautiful blooms.

Key Characteristics of Good Soil for Flower Beds

Before diving into specific amendments, it’s helpful to understand what makes good flower bed soil:

  • Loamy texture: A balance of sand, silt, and clay allows good drainage yet retains moisture.
  • Rich in organic matter: Organic matter improves fertility and soil structure.
  • Neutral to slightly acidic pH (6.0–7.0): Most flowers prefer this pH range.
  • Well-aerated: Roots need oxygen to function properly.
  • Rich microbial life: Healthy microbial populations help break down organic matter and make nutrients available.

The right organic amendments can help achieve these conditions.

Top Organic Soil Amendments for Flower Beds

1. Compost

Compost is arguably the most beneficial and widely used organic amendment. It consists of decomposed organic matter such as kitchen scraps, yard waste, leaves, and manure.

Benefits:

  • Adds a broad spectrum of nutrients in a slow-release form.
  • Improves soil structure by increasing aeration and moisture retention.
  • Encourages beneficial microbial activity.
  • Buffers soil pH toward neutral.
  • Suppresses some plant diseases through enhanced microbial diversity.

Application Tips:

Spread a 2 to 3-inch layer of finished compost over your flower beds each spring or fall. Work it gently into the top 6–8 inches of soil without disturbing established roots. Compost can also be used as mulch to retain moisture and regulate temperature.


2. Well-Rotted Manure

Animal manure from cows, horses, chickens, or rabbits is a nutrient-rich amendment favored for adding nitrogen and other essential elements.

Benefits:

  • Supplies nitrogen, phosphorus, potassium, and micronutrients.
  • Improves soil structure when well-aged.
  • Increases microbial activity.

Important Note: Only use well-rotted (aged) manure to avoid burning plants or introducing pathogens.

Application Tips:

Incorporate 1–2 inches of rotted manure into the flower bed before planting. Avoid fresh manure during flowering seasons due to its high nitrogen content which can promote leaf growth over blooms.


3. Peat Moss

Peat moss is partially decomposed sphagnum moss harvested from peat bogs. It is popular for its ability to improve moisture retention.

Benefits:

  • Increases water retention in sandy soils.
  • Improves soil aeration.
  • Slightly acidic pH ideal for acid-loving flowers such as azaleas or rhododendrons.

Considerations:

Peat moss is not very nutrient-rich and has a low pH (3.5–4.5), so it should be used judiciously. Its harvesting is controversial due to environmental concerns—consider alternatives like coconut coir if sustainability is a priority.

Application Tips:

Mix peat moss with other amendments like compost to balance pH and nutrient levels. Use about 1–2 inches incorporated into the topsoil before planting.


4. Coconut Coir

A sustainable alternative to peat moss made from shredded coconut husks. It offers similar moisture retention properties without lowering pH drastically.

Benefits:

  • Retains moisture while improving aeration.
  • Neutral pH around 5.5–6.8 suits most flowers.
  • Renewable resource with less environmental impact than peat moss.

Application Tips:

Hydrate dry coir blocks before applying them mixed into the topsoil at about 2 inches depth.


5. Leaf Mold

Leaf mold is decomposed leaves that have turned into crumbly, dark humus after months of decomposition.

Benefits:

  • Improves moisture retention.
  • Enhances soil crumb structure.
  • Rich in beneficial fungi that aid root growth.

Leaf mold offers less immediate nutrient boost compared to compost but greatly benefits soil texture and microbial life.

Application Tips:

Use leaf mold as a top dressing or mix into flower bed soil at a ratio of up to 25%. It works particularly well combined with compost.


6. Worm Castings (Vermicompost)

Worm castings are nutrient-rich excrement from earthworms that contain readily available nutrients and beneficial microbes.

Benefits:

  • Supplies macro and micronutrients naturally balanced.
  • Stimulates plant growth hormones.
  • Promotes healthy root development.

Worm castings are less bulky than compost but incredibly potent.

Application Tips:

Mix worm castings into planting holes or spread as a light top dressing around flowers every few weeks during growing season. Avoid over-applying; about 10–20% by volume mixed into potting soil or flower bed works best.


7. Alfalfa Meal

Alfalfa meal is ground dried alfalfa plants commonly used as an organic fertilizer and soil conditioner.

Benefits:

  • Contains nitrogen, phosphorus, potassium, plus trace minerals.
  • Contains triacontanol, a natural growth stimulant that improves photosynthesis.

Alfalfa meal provides moderate nutrients while stimulating overall plant vigor.

Application Tips:

Broadcast 1–2 pounds per 100 square feet on flower beds in early spring or mid-season. Incorporate lightly into the soil surface and water thoroughly.


8. Rock Dust / Mineral Amendments

Rock dusts like basalt or granite dust replenish trace minerals often lacking in garden soils such as calcium, magnesium, iron, and silica.

Benefits:

  • Improves mineral content for healthier flowers.
  • Enhances microbial activity by providing essential micronutrients.

Rock dusts act slowly but build long-term fertility when combined with organic matter.

Application Tips:

Apply rock dust at rates recommended by suppliers—typically 5–10 pounds per 100 square feet—and incorporate into the soil once per year during bed preparation.


How to Choose the Right Amendment for Your Flower Beds

Selecting appropriate amendments depends on several factors:

  1. Soil Testing: Before amending, conduct a soil test through your local extension service or using DIY kits to identify nutrient deficiencies and pH levels.
  2. Soil Texture: Sandy soils benefit from moisture-retaining amendments like compost or coir; clay soils improve with aerating materials such as composted leaves or coarse compost.
  3. Flower Types: Acid-loving plants benefit from more acidic amendments like peat moss; most garden flowers thrive in neutral pH soils amended with balanced inputs like compost or worm castings.
  4. Availability: Use locally available organic materials when possible for cost efficiency and environmental sustainability.
  5. Sustainability: Consider renewability—use coconut coir instead of peat moss when possible; practice responsible sourcing for manure and rock dusts.

Application Best Practices

  • Always apply amendments before planting by mixing them thoroughly into the topsoil (top 6–8 inches).
  • Avoid applying excessive amounts that can lead to nutrient imbalance or poor drainage.
  • Use mulch over amended soils to conserve moisture and slowly add organic material as it breaks down.
  • Reapply amendments annually or biannually depending on plant demand and previous results.

Conclusion

Organic soil amendments are vital tools for cultivating lush, healthy flower beds full of vibrant blooms year after year. Compost remains the gold standard due to its comprehensive benefits but integrating multiple amendments such as worm castings, aged manure, leaf mold, and mineral dusts ensures balanced nutrition and optimal growing conditions tailored for your garden’s unique needs.

By investing time in selecting quality organic materials and following sound application methods, gardeners can create flourishing flower beds that support biodiversity, improve soil health sustainably, and reward with stunning floral displays season after season.
